What's Rome City Centre like?
People go to Rome City Centre to see popular places such as Trevi Fountain, and to take in culture at top venues such as Vatican Museums. Travellers like the neighbourhood for its art scene and beautiful river views. Pantheon and Piazza Navona are a couple of popular sights that will definitely leave an impression.
How to get to Rome City Centre
Rome City Centre is located 0.3 mi (0.6 km) from the heart of Rome.
Flying to:
- Rome (FCO-Fiumicino - Leonardo da Vinci Intl.), 13.8 mi (22.3 km) from Rome City Centre
- Ciampino Airport (CIA), 8.9 mi (14.3 km) from Rome City Centre
